Well with mine...
The company that made it (VRInsight) made a bad batch at an early stage.
They recalled them all, or so everyone thought.
When I recieved mine, it had the exact same symptoms as described by the manufacturer, USB cable wasn't working and basically everytime you move the throttles it would disconect ???
So some clever person had given me one of that batch :(
That's why I had to send it back, which is why I'm annoyed I had to pay for postage back.
